📊 Average Salary Range (2026)

In Lexington, KY, IT Support Specialists earn competitive wages compared to state and national averages:

MetricAnnual Salary
Average Salary~$61,926 per year
Typical Range$48,000 – $79,600
Glassdoor Estimated Median~$67,000
Glassdoor Range (Total Pay)$54,000 – $84,000

According to Indeed data, the average base salary for IT Support Specialists in Lexington is around $61,926 annually, with lower earnings around $48,178 and higher earners near $79,596. Glassdoor’s figures also show a typical range roughly between $54K and $84K depending on employer and experience level.

💡 Note: Salary variation exists between employers and industries, especially between public sector employers like universities and private tech firms.

👩‍💻 Salary by Experience

Here’s an overview of typical earning levels based on experience:

Experience LevelExpected Salary
Entry‑Level (0–2 years)~$48,000 – $55,000
Mid‑Level (3–5 years)~$56,000 – $68,000
Senior (5+ years)~$68,000 – $84,000+

Though exact tiers aren’t published locally, salary ranges from data sites reflect a clear upward trend in wages as experience increases.


📍 Lexington vs Nearby Cities

Understanding local salary comparisons helps gauge earning potential in context:

CityTypical IT Support Salary
Lexington, KY$61,900 – $67,000
Louisville, KY~$55,700 (average reported)
Elizabethtown, KY~$62,400 (higher local average)

Lexington’s market for IT support jobs generally pays slightly more than the Kentucky average, although larger cities or tech hubs may offer higher overall compensation.
